“Dad. Will you play with me?” I must hear this question a dozen times a night and even more on the weekends. My 4-year old daughter always wants dad to play with her. Most of the time, we’re using some sort of figurine (Dora and Tip are the most popular lately) to pretend we’re doing some daily chore like going to the grocery store or to Target. We lead exciting lives, I know.
At the end of a long day, getting down on the floor is the last thing I want to do. But, I remind myself that soon, she won’t want anything to do with me. So, more often than not, I try to indulge her.
The lesson I’ve learned in trading is you have to put in the work. After I get done playing with her, and get ready for the next day, it’s usually around 8:00. It’s difficult sometimes to force myself to fire up the laptop to do my scans and watch video lessons. But, at the same time, I know I won’t reach my individual and financial goals without putting in the work.
And, it seems, at least for me, that taking one day off is like being gone for a week. A lot of plays carry over from day to day. If I take one day off, I miss more than just that day.
So, remember, if you want financial independence, you must commit, study, and work each day to improve.
